Davanagere: Guide to the City, Top Businesses & FAQs

Davanagere, also known as the "Granary of Karnataka," is a prominent city situated in the central part of Karnataka, India. It serves as the administrative headquarters of Davanagere district and is strategically located at the crossroads of major rail and road networks, making it a vital commercial hub. With a rich historical background dating back centuries, Davanagere has transformed from a modest settlement to a bustling urban center, thanks to its thriving industries and agriculture-based economy.

The city is known for its contribution to the textile industry, manufacturing, and agribusiness sectors. It boasts a diverse population, influencing its cultural landscape with a blend of traditional festivals, cuisine, and modern urban amenities. The city's climate is generally semiarid, with hot summers, moderate monsoons, and mild winters, making it suitable for agriculture, especially the cultivation of maize, pulses, and oilseeds.

Education and healthcare are well developed in Davanagere, with numerous educational institutions, hospitals, and research centers. The city is also witnessing infrastructural growth with enhanced connectivity, including the ongoing development of the national highway network and railway improvements. Overall, Davanagere exemplifies rapid urban growth while maintaining its agricultural roots, contributing significantly to Karnataka's economy and culture.
